Core Formula Behind Every Fraction Subraction Calculator
When denominators are different, subtraction uses this identity:
a/b – c/d = (ad – bc) / bd
After that, simplify by dividing numerator and denominator by their greatest common divisor (GCD). If the output needs to be a mixed number, divide the absolute numerator by denominator and keep the remainder as the fractional part. If the value is negative, keep the sign on the whole mixed result.
- Step 1: Convert mixed numbers to improper fractions.
- Step 2: Build a common denominator.
- Step 3: Subtract numerators in equivalent form.
- Step 4: Simplify using GCD.
- Step 5: Convert to mixed form or decimal if requested.
Worked Example You Can Verify with This Calculator
Suppose you want to compute 1 3/4 – 2/3.
- Convert mixed number: 1 3/4 = 7/4.
- Use common denominator: for 4 and 3, denominator becomes 12.
- Equivalent forms: 7/4 = 21/12 and 2/3 = 8/12.
- Subtract: 21/12 – 8/12 = 13/12.
- Simplified fraction: 13/12 (already reduced).
- Mixed number format: 1 1/12.
- Decimal format: 1.083333…

Comparison Table: U.S. Math Performance Context (NAEP)
Fraction fluency is strongly tied to broader mathematics performance. The National Center for Education Statistics (NCES) publishes NAEP data that highlights ongoing challenges in school mathematics achievement.
| Grade Level | At or Above Proficient (2019) | At or Above Proficient (2022) | Change (percentage points) |
|---|---|---|---|
| Grade 4 Mathematics | 41% | 36% | -5 |
| Grade 8 Mathematics | 34% | 26% | -8 |
Source context: NAEP mathematics reporting from NCES. These figures illustrate why targeted skill tools, including fraction subtraction practice, are important in day-to-day learning plans.

A reliable fraction subraction calculator should also handle negative outputs gracefully. If the second fraction is larger than the first, the result becomes negative. Good tools preserve the sign and still simplify the magnitude.

Frequent Errors the Fraction Subraction Calculator Helps Prevent
- Subtracting denominators directly, which is incorrect.
- Forgetting to convert mixed numbers to improper form.
- Losing a negative sign during conversion.
- Failing to simplify final results.
- Incorrect borrowing when subtracting mixed numbers manually.
- Using denominator 0, which is undefined in rational arithmetic.

Also include estimation before exact solving. For example, if you compute 3/4 – 1/5, you should expect a little over one-half. If a computed result is larger than 1 or negative, your estimate immediately flags a likely mistake. Combining estimation with calculator verification is one of the fastest ways to improve reliability.
